Maury, I''ll do for $150.

Actually, I use "Firestone". They offer a lifetime alignment service. I can't remember the price (approx $125) but it is well worth it. I have mine checked every month...sometimes more depending on how I drive it. You would be surprised how just a small bump can knock our alignment out of spec. Our tires are too expensive to be chewed up by bad alignment.

In my opinion, no S2K owner should be without this deal. I have never driven a car that has been so sensitive to minor tire and/or alignment changes.
